A cobra is nothing more than an inertia-aided high alpha stall, and recovery. It is useless in combat.The maneuver that is useful, is known as the hook. That is accomplished during a pursuit, and utilizes the same principle as the cobra, but is normally executed n the horizontal plane. It allows the attacking pilot to momentarily pull lead on his target during a gun pass.

The air-to surface version of the Brahmos cruise missile for the Su-30MKI has not yet been made. The surface to surface missile is operational with frontline warships of the Indian Navy and some units of the Indian Army.
The Air to surface version of the Brahmos will be much smaller that can be slung under the centerline pylon of the Su-30MKI. The Anti-ship missles used by the IAF on Su-30MKI are Kh-31A2(AS-17 Krypton) and Kh-59M(AS-18 Kazoo).I have got a pic of a Kh-31 being mounted on the wing of a 20 Sqdn Su-30MKI.

The aircraft which your are making is a Su-30MK and not Su-30MKI. The MKI is a generation ahead of the "MK" variants with thrust vector nozzles, capable of firing R-77, TV guided missiles, LGBs,Indian mission computers, Israeli French avionics.

Indian Su-30MKs:
The first batch of eight Su-30MKs (SB 001 - SB 008), delivered to the IAF, have evolved from the Su-27K long range interceptor, a two-seat fighter derivative of the Su-27PU, which in itself is a two-seat fighter derivative of the Su-27UB trainer. These aircraft have the standard Su-27 radar, an in-flight refuelling capability, limited air-to-ground capability and a data-link system. The second batch, originally built to fulfill a cancelled Indonesian order, of ten Su-30Ks (SB 009 - SB 018) have limited PGM (Precision Guided Munitions) capability.
The Su-30Ks and MKs were inducted into IAF's No. 24 "Hawks" Sqdn (serial nos SB001 to SB018). Soon these Su-30MK and Ks will go back to Russia and replaced by new Su-30MKIs. the ex-Indian Su-30MKs will be brought upto SU-30KN standards and re-sold to Belarus.
